The use of 'nya' suffix in Malay/Indonesian
How, why & when to use nya?

He went back to his house = Dia pulang ke rumahnya.
-nya is acting as the third person (singular) in possessive case (his/hers/its). However, it doesn't work for 'theirs'.

Hey dude, just been in Malaysia for 6months. Not sure if this is correct but I had the same question, a lady called a child "comelnya", comel = cute + nya, when I heard this over and over to me it made sense of "nya" = "possession of". So comel in English means "cute", but comelnya in English could be "cuteness" or "to possess a high quality/level of being cute". Spicy would be "pedas" but "pedasnya" would be spiciness or "to possess a high quality/level of spice". It makes sense also when emphasising.
